Low Packet Latency & High Performance
The PEX 8606 architecture supports packet cut-thru with a maximum latency of
190ns in x1 to x1 configuration. This, combined with large packet memory and
non-blocking internal switch architecture, provides full line rate on all ports for low-
latency applications such as communications and embedded. The low latency
enables applications to achieve high throughput and performance. In addition to low
latency, the device supports a max payload size of 2048 bytes, enabling the user to
achieve even higher throughout
Data Integrity
The PEX 8606 provides end-to-end CRC protection (ECRC) and Poison bit support
to enable designs that require guaranteed error-free packets. PLX also supports
data path parity and memory (RAM) error correction as packets pass through the
switch
Dual-Host and Fail-Over Support
The PEX 8606 supports full non-transparent bridging (NTB) functionality to allow
implementation of multi-host systems and intelligent I/O modules in applications
which require redundancy support such as communications, storage, and servers.
Non-transparent bridges allow systems to isolate host memory domains by
presenting the processor subsystem as an endpoint rather than another memory
system. Base address registers are used to translate addresses; doorbell registers are
used to send interrupts between the address domains; and scratchpad registers are
accessible from both address domains to allow inter-processor communication
Interoperability
The PEX 8606 is designed to be fully compliant with the PCI Express Base
Specification r2.0 and is backwards compatible to PCI Express Base Specification
r1.1 and r1.0a. Additionally each port supports auto-negotiation, lane reversal and
polarity reversal. Furthermore, the PEX 8606 is designed for Microsoft Vista
compliance. All PLX switches undergo thorough interoperability testing in PLX’s
Interoperability Lab and compliance testing at the PCI-SIG plug-fest to ensure
compatibility with PCI Express devices in the market.
